Feels Like Temperature'''
This was not available in MX at versions below 3.5.4 (released 25 Apr 2020) build 3075. When you view an earlier log for all lines, this field will be blank. After that release was installed your standard logs will have this field set in every line.
When you bring up a line to edit for the first time, two figures will be shown below the input field (regardless of whether it is empty or already populated). The first figure (not having round brackets round it) is the figure calculated in the way it was done at version 3.5.4, and still being done at version 3.6.7 (build 3083). The second figure is how the developer now believes it should be calculated.
